Each failed delivery re-enters the queue with exponential backoff and full jitter; retries are capped so a misbehaving receiver cannot monopolize worker slots. From a security standpoint, note that payloads are re-signed on every attempt, so replayed deliveries remain verifiable, and dead-lettered events are encrypted at rest. Peak retry load during the Fenwood outage stayed under 12% of steady-state throughput. The constants below govern the backoff schedule and queue ceilings.

tuning table, yajog-yahof:
BUDGETS = {
    "lamvan": 303,
    "wenox": 460,
    "fenvan": 525,
}

Warranty-Cost Overrun — Managers Only

For the incoming director: warranty claims on the Stilmore K2 range ran 38% over forecast this year, driven chiefly by a hinge defect traced to the Pellan Ridge supplier line. Remediation, supplier negotiations, and reserve adjustments are documented in the linked pages. The confidential note on forward business plans appears below.

internal memo for kawip-hadug: Headcount on the Wenwyn team goes from 7 to 140 by the end of January. Gross margin on Wenwyn came in at 20 percent against a plan of 15 percent.

Briefing — Leadership Review: Pricing of the Astrelle Line

Prepared for the Brenmark Holdings board. Current Astrelle pricing sits roughly 9% below comparable offerings, sustaining volume but compressing margin. We propose a staged uplift over two quarters, paired with bundled service tiers to soften churn risk. Full sensitivity modelling is appended. The confidential note on related business plans appears directly below.

board note of bajop-yaweg: The western region missed its Pelys quota by 58.0 percent last quarter. Pelysek Foods plans to raise the Belius list price by 44.0 percent in July. The steering committee signed off on a budget of $133.8 million for Project Pelax. The renewal with Zoraelix Systems closes at $61.9 million a year, 12.7 percent above the last contract.